CGN: Building a modern factory in barren deserts and developing a new win-win cooperation model along “Belt and Road”

2018-09-05Sino-Swedish CSR Websiteadmin0010

 

Company profile
 
China General Nuclear Power Corporation (CGN) was founded in September 1994. Missioned with developing clean energy to benefit human society, the company focuses on the development of clean energies such as nuclear power, nuclear fuel, wind power, and solar power globally in a cross-regional and multi-base way. It also gains sound development in nuclear technology, finance, public utilities, energy-saving technologies, etc.

Solutions
 
In 2012, CGN Uranium Resources Co., Ltd. and the China-Africa Development Fund successfully acquired the Namibia Husab mine, which is the single biggest industrial investment by China in Africa so far. Since completing the acquisition and beginning to prepare for the construction, CGN has adhered to the philosophy of win-win cooperation, actively taken measures to reduce the impact of project construction on the environment, and worked hard to integrate into local communities and promote local economic and social development, thus creating a new win-win cooperation mode of “Belt and Road”.
 
Cultivating local talents
 
Native Namibian personnel is the main driving force for the development of Husab uranium mine. In 2017, the proportion of local employees in Husab uranium mine had reached 95%. To further enhance the capacity of local talents, CGN has invested nearly 200 million Namibian dollars to provide systematic training for employees in different positions and at different ranks such as contractor workers, maintenance workers and operation operators.
 
Taking the drivers of mining equipment as an example, CGN has provided theoretical training, 3D simulation training of mine road scene and field practical operation training for them. The combination of theory and practice enables the drivers to operate the mine cars with a loading capacity of 330 tons skillfully.
 
Protecting rare plants
 
To protect the ecology of desert, CGN strives to minimize the effects on environment throughout the whole process of project construction. In the early stage of the project, to protect welwitschia mirabilis, the national flower of Namibia and one of the “eight rarest plants in the world”, CGN hired local botanists to study it together and optimized the route design of the project. According to the original plan, 200 of the species needed to be transplanted, but only 3 were eventually transplanted.
 
Promoting community culture
 
To enrich local culture, CGN continues to held the “Husab Cup” marathon, which has become one of the largest marathon events on the African continent. On August 5, 2017, the third “Husab Cup” marathon kicked off in Namibia, which attracted over 780 professional marathon runners and amateur long-distance runners from China, Namibia, Zambia, South Africa and other countries. The number of participants hit a new high. The spare money of the marathon preparation fund was donated to local primary schools to improve sports facilities and to support the development of sports and culture in Namibia.
 
In addition, CGN has specially set up the Sike Foundation and launched projects like development support for small and medium-sized enterprises, donation to kindergartens and schools, and the construction of the National Disaster Relief Center of Namibia to promote the progress of local small and medium-sized enterprises, education and communities in various aspects.
 
Achievement
 
Social benefits
 
The “Husab Cup” marathon which has been held for three consecutive years, has become one of the largest marathon events in Namibia, which effectively promotes the development of sports and culture in Namibia and facilitates the integration of different countries and cultures.
 
The Sike Foundation, which provides special funds to support youth employment, food supply, drought relief, was highly recognized and appreciated by the Namibian president Geingob, for its contribution to “economic development”, “social progress”, “infrastructure construction” and “international relations” in the common prosperity plan.
 
Environmental benefit
 
The Husab uranium mine project has carried out the environmental protection concept from engineering construction to operation and production, and the impact of production and operation on the environment was reduced to the minimum. Before the construction, the company cooperated with local experts to conduct research on rare animals and plants, optimized project design route and reduced transplantation. After it was put into production, the company strictly abides by local laws and regulations, handles waste discharge properly and has realized green development.
 
Economic benefit
 
Husab uranium mine is China’s largest investment project in Africa. According to the statistics of the Chinese embassy in Namibia, the total investment of Chinese enterprises in Namibia is about USD 3 billion, while the investment of CGN on Husab uranium mine accounts for 73%. After the Husab project was put into production, it pays a tax of 1.1 to 1.7 billion Namibia dollars to the Namibian government each year, making Namibia the world’s second largest producer and exporter of natural uranium. The country’s exports increased by 20% and the GDP increased by 5%. It has also created thousands of jobs. On February 23, 2017, after learning that Husab uranium mine had successfully produced the first barrel of uranium, the Namibian President Geingob sent a congratulatory letter through the Chinese Foreign Ministry, which said, “Namibia has an economy of less than USD10 billion a year. However, the Husab uranium mine project which is heavenly invested makes an outstanding contribution to improving our country’s employment, revenue and capacity. We welcome such investors.”
